Slight sound driver issue after Windows 7 upgrade

    Hello, after recently upgrading to windows 7 from xp on my Packard Bell imedia 2770 one of the first things i noticed was my front panel audio stopped working, i.e. no sound through my headphones. I have my speakers plugged in the back & before the upgrade would always use the front for my headphones.

    Quick google & i found out this is quiet a common problem but i found a fix described in this link:

    http://www.alltipsandtricks.com/realtek-front-panel-audio-not-working-windows-7/

    Realtek HD Audio was the program that came on the computer from the start with xp so i went ahead & downloaded the latest version & used the fix described in the link.

    Now the problem is that Realtek doesn’t seem to retain the settings after i restart the computer meaning if i want the front panel connection to work I’ve to go in & tick the box everytime. & also Realtek doesn't seem to load up in the system tray on start up straight away & instead seems to reinstall everytime, i get a loading type icon in the tray first then a pop up saying drivers installed.

    I imagine the fact it keeps reinstalling itself is why it’s not retaining settings?

    I'm using the Realtek program cos there seems to be no way to get the front panel working with windows only. I've seen fixes mentioning going into the bios & making sure that the front panel audio is set to AC 97 not HD(in the link above & loads of other sites) but when i go into my bios i see absolutely nothing like what is described, no mention of 'CHIPSET' or any mention of any audio related settings.

    To summarise: all the fixes on see on the net mention the realtek fix but it doesn’t seem to stay fixed on my machine.


    Any advice?
